Sign In | Join Free | My frbiz.com |
|
A0001420106 SCR System Parts Adblue Urea Pump Repair Parts For Mercedes Benz Urea Pump Parts Quick Details: 1. Payment: TT Paypal 2. Car Fitment: Mercedes benz 3. OEM: A0001420106 4. Brand: WEGO 5. ...